Why You Need Fabric Upholstery Cleaner

Fabric furniture can soak up smells and stains. Regular cleaning keeps it looking good and smelling fresh. It also helps your furniture last longer.

Key Features to Look For

When you shop for upholstery cleaner, keep these important features in mind:

1. Cleaning Power
  • Stain Removal: Does it tackle common stains like coffee, wine, or pet messes? Look for cleaners that specifically mention stain-fighting abilities.
  • Odor Elimination: Some cleaners just cover up smells. The best ones get rid of odors completely.
  • Deep Cleaning: Can it reach deep into the fabric fibers to lift dirt and grime?
2. Fabric Compatibility
  • Type of Fabric: Not all cleaners work on all fabrics. Check if the cleaner is safe for your sofa’s material (like cotton, linen, polyester, or microfiber). Always test in a hidden spot first!
  • Colorfastness: Will it fade your fabric’s color? A good cleaner won’t change the color of your upholstery.
3. Ease of Use
  • Spray Bottle vs. Concentrate: Spray bottles are easy to use for quick spot cleaning. Concentrates need to be mixed with water, which can be more economical for larger jobs.
  • Drying Time: How long does it take for the fabric to dry after cleaning? Faster drying means less waiting.
  • No Rinsing Required: Some cleaners don’t need to be rinsed off, saving you time and effort.
4. Safety and Ingredients
  • Non-Toxic Formulas: Are there harsh chemicals? Look for cleaners that are gentle and safe for your family and pets.
  • Hypoallergenic Options: If you or someone in your home has allergies, a hypoallergenic cleaner is a great choice.
  • Eco-Friendly: Some cleaners use natural or biodegradable ingredients, which are better for the environment.

Important Materials and What They Mean

You’ll see different types of cleaners. Knowing what they are helps you choose:

  • Foam Cleaners: These create a dry foam that lifts dirt. They are good because they use less moisture, which helps prevent water stains and speeds up drying.
  • Spray Cleaners: These are the most common. You spray them on, let them sit, and then wipe or blot them away. They are convenient for quick cleanups.
  • Shampoo/Liquid Cleaners: These are often stronger and might require more effort, sometimes needing rinsing. They can be very effective for tough stains.
  • Wipes: These are pre-moistened cloths. They are perfect for small, fresh spills and very easy to use.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

  • Improves Quality:
    • Enzymatic Formulas: These use enzymes to break down organic stains (like pet messes or food spills). They are very effective.
    • pH-Balanced Formulas: A balanced pH means the cleaner is less likely to damage delicate fabrics.
    • Pleasant, Mild Scent: A clean smell is good, but an overpowering perfume can be a sign of harsh chemicals.
  • Reduces Quality:
    • Harsh Chemicals (Bleach, Ammonia): These can damage fabric, fade colors, and leave strong fumes.
    • Excessive Residue: If a cleaner leaves a sticky or chalky residue, it attracts more dirt.
    • Strong, Chemical Odors: This often means the product is harsh and may not be safe.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)**

Q: How do I choose the right upholstery cleaner for my sofa?

A: Check your sofa’s care tag first. Then, pick a cleaner that matches your fabric type and the kind of stains you have.

Q: Can I use any upholstery cleaner on all fabrics?

A: No. Always test the cleaner on a small, hidden area of your furniture first to make sure it won’t damage the fabric or color.

Q: What is the best way to remove pet stains?

A: Look for an enzymatic cleaner. These break down the stain and odor from the source.

Q: How often should I clean my upholstery?

A: For spot cleaning, clean spills right away. For a general refresh, once or twice a year is usually good, or more often if needed.

Q: Will upholstery cleaner make my furniture smell bad?

A: Some cleaners have strong chemical smells. It’s best to choose one with a mild or fresh scent, or an unscented option.

Q: What is “colorfastness”?

A: Colorfastness means the fabric’s color won’t fade or bleed when cleaned.

Q: Should I use a lot of water when cleaning?

A: No. Too much water can lead to water stains or mold. Use the cleaner as directed and blot, don’t soak.

Q: Are foam cleaners better than spray cleaners?

A: Foam cleaners use less moisture and dry faster, which is good for preventing stains. Spray cleaners are convenient for quick jobs.

Q: Can I use upholstery cleaner on my car seats?

A: Yes, many upholstery cleaners are safe for car seats, but always check the product label and test first.

Q: What does “non-toxic” mean for a cleaner?

A: Non-toxic means the cleaner is made without harmful chemicals that could be bad for your health or the environment.
